Last updated: April 2026 dataOil-country tubular goods (OCTG) in the casing category are engineered to line wellbores and withstand formation pressures, with API 5CT grade and connection type (e.g., buttress, long-round) being the primary commercial specifications. Casing is among the most trade-remedy-sensitive steel products in the US market, with antidumping and countervailing duty orders covering imports from multiple origins — a landscape that has shifted significantly over successive sunset reviews. Section 232 tariff measures layer on top of any applicable ADD/CVD duties, so landed-cost modeling must account for both.

Casing is run into the wellbore to stabilize the formation and isolate pressure zones; tubing is the smaller-diameter pipe run inside the casing to convey produced fluids to the surface. They are classified in separate SITC subheadings (67932 for casing, 67942 for casing and tubing combined), and antidumping order scope language often distinguishes them by outer diameter ranges and end-finish specifications.
Importers should check the CBP ADD/CVD search tool and the relevant USITC order for the specific country of origin, outer diameter range, and grade. Scope rulings issued by the Department of Commerce can clarify whether a particular product falls within an order's coverage, and requesting a scope ruling before importation is advisable when the product's specifications are near the boundary of the order's description.
